Comment effectuer une restauration lorsque vous avez deux conteneurs ?

Hmmm,
non, ça ne fonctionne toujours pas.

J’ai le fichier de sauvegarde ici :

thommie@docker2:/var/discourse/shared/web-only$ ls  
backups  log  netzwissen-forum-2023-10-09-201019-v20230913194832.tar.gz

Puis

root@docker2:/var/discourse# ./launcher enter web_only

x86_64 arch detected.  
root@forum:/var/www/discourse#

root@forum:/var/www/discourse# discourse restore  
You must provide a filename to restore. Did you mean one of the following?  
  
discourse restore forum-netzwissen-eu-2023-10-08-033221-v20230926165821.tar.gz

Donc, la restauration ne montre qu’un fichier de sauvegarde provenant de l’intérieur du conteneur web_only de la nouvelle instance de forum (la cible de la sauvegarde). Mais pas le fichier de sauvegarde de l’instance source qui est disponible sur /var/discourse/shared/web-only/ sur le système HOST.

Donc, le “discourse restore” n’utilise pas le volume mappé sur l’hôte, mais seulement celui à l’intérieur du conteneur.

??